Abstract

The utility model discloses a kind of construction structure shockproof node, including main body, envelope is installed between the main body and repaiies plate, the outside that the envelope repaiies plate is equipped with trim panel, and the top of the trim panel is equipped with floor, and the inner side of the floor is equipped with crack-resistant layer, the right side of the crack-resistant layer is equipped with fluid sealant, the inner side of the fluid sealant is equipped with water blocking, and parapet is provided with above the water blocking, Bituminous hemp fiber is equipped between the parapet.The construction structure shockproof node; the cooperation between plate, trim panel is repaiied by main body, envelope; the filled bitumen flax silk between main body; main body can be made to be moved in limit range, Hard link, which will not occur, causes steel power excessive, under the action of waterproof layer, finishing coat, insulating layer and crack-resistant layer; main body and floor is set preferably to be protected; it is set not corroded from the boisterous influence such as sleet by phenomena such as acid rain, freeze thawing and cold bridge, so that the service life that ensure that main body of main body.

- 3 are please referred to Fig.1, the utility model provides a kind of technical solution:A kind of construction structure shockproof node, including main body 1, main body 1 is poured for armored concrete and formed, and is built space and is used for owner, the top of main body 1 is equipped with baffle 21, baffle 21 Material is stainless steel, and for stopping that rainwater pours into main body 1, baffle 21 is connected by side plate 23 with the inner wall of mandril 22, side Plate 23 is stainless steel, is used to support and bears down on one 21, and the top of mandril 22, which is provided with, bears down on one 24, and it 24 is stainless steel to bear down on one, It is closely sealed for being overlapped with side plate 23, prevent in rainwater intrusion main body 1, forming freeze thawing influences the service life of main body 1, bears down on one 24 Right side is equipped with block 25, and block 25 wraps up rubber block for aluminum veneer, spends the space for subsidizing 24 right sides of bearing down on one, pacifies between main body 1 Plate 2 is repaiied equipped with envelope, it is aluminum veneer that envelope, which repaiies plate 2, and for the distance between main body 1 to be closed, the outside that envelope repaiies plate 2 is equipped with trim panel 3, trim panel 3 is plasterboard, and for base course wall is levelling, the top of trim panel 3 is equipped with floor 4, and floor 4 is armored concrete Pour and be made, for connecting the partition wall between main body 1, become the top plate in room and room is closed, the outside of floor 4 is set There is waterproof layer 5, waterproof layer 5 is asphalt felt, by scorching softening, can be filled and led up the gap between floor 4 and concrete base layer, The inner side of floor 4 is equipped with finishing coat 6, and finishing coat 6 is concrete layer after preserving period, polishes its surface, is polishing One layer of seal coat is smeared on layer, for waterproof sealing, the inner side of finishing coat 6 is equipped with insulating layer 7, and insulating layer 7 is composite international The A level fire proofing materials of fire safety rules grade, the inner side of floor 4 are equipped with crack-resistant layer 8, and crack-resistant layer 8 is alkaline adhesive waterproof tape, it has Toughness, can be used in concreting process because vibrate not exclusively caused by gully or cavity, can be blocked with it, The right side of crack-resistant layer 8 is equipped with fluid sealant 9, and fluid sealant 9 is weather proofing sealant, for side and position that crack-resistant layer 8 joins is close Envelope, prevents rainwater from invading, and the inner side of fluid sealant 9 is equipped with water blocking 10, and water blocking 10 is made of concreting, for when rainy, Stop rainwater and export rainwater according to predetermined slope water, the top of water blocking 10 is provided with parapet 11, and parapet 11 is brick Folder reinforcing bar is built by laying bricks or stones, when someone is in roof operation, is played the role of blocking, is prevented it from falling, and pitch fiber crops are equipped between parapet 11 Silk 12, Bituminous hemp fiber 12 are used for the space for filling main body 1, and the left and right sides of Bituminous hemp fiber 12 is mounted on dripping eaves 13, drips Water eaves 13 is used to make rainwater prolong its gradient trickling figure outlet pipe, and the outer wall of dripping eaves 13 is equipped with float coat 14, and float coat 14 is general For the levelling plastering trypsin method emulsion paint of cement, the upper surface of float coat 14 is provided with seal plate 15, and seal plate 15 is stainless steel Matter, for preventing rainwater from invading, seal plate 15 is connected by stent 17 with the inner wall of pressing plate 18, and the material of stent 17 is stainless steel Material, is used to support pressing plate 18, and the top of pressing plate 18 is provided with slope eaves 16, and the material of slope eaves 16 is stainless steel, for preventing Only rainwater invades, and the lower section of slope eaves 16 is equipped with buried plate 19, and buried plate 19 is sprays antirust paint outside iron plate, for being incited somebody to action before main body 1 pours It is installed on reinforcing bar, it is become a main body with the main body 1 after pouring molding, and since it is metal material, to master When body 1 carries out the operation such as welding, it is more prone to operate, rock wool layer 20 is equipped between buried plate 19, rock wool layer 20 is mainly used for preventing fires, Rock wool belongs to A grades of fire proofing materials, meets national requirements.
When an earthquake occurs, the house to collapse, mainly makes because of the unreasonable of its shockproof structure design, most of anti- All in the shearing force of the intersubjective horizontal steel power of reduction as far as possible and longitudinal direction, we have often been brought into a mistaken ideas by this for shake, and To fix main body 1, make its it is indestructible would not collapse, it was proved that, setting up some structures in main body 1 makes It can be subjected to displacement in controllable scope, enable main body 1 that earthquake to be brought to the shearing of its internal steel power and longitudinal direction Power is discharged or passed, and is one of more effective method, and when coming earthquake, steel power is passed to main body 1 by ground, It can then tremble between main body 1, under the action of Bituminous hemp fiber 12 and seal plate 15, main body 1 can be in the model of setting Rock and will not mutually collide in enclosing, it is such so as to avoid the transmission of direct steel power or direct shearing power between main body 1 It is hard to transmit, can only cause expansion and shock between main body 1, cause the inside of main body 1 to be broken, by Bituminous hemp fiber 12, Seal plate 15 and envelope repair it is closed between plate 2, make its it is internal produced without negative pressure, Bituminous hemp fiber 12 can effectively shed part again Steel power, so that the steel power between main body 1 declines, avoids main body 1 and collides, and completes earthquake resistance and prevention work.
